Inspect and Clean Machinery, Tools and Equipment to Preserve Biosecurity
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)
This course includes training in identifying weeds and washdown requirements and carrying out wash down tasks. Participants will learn about the obligations‚ documentation and reporting activities required, as well as how to appropriately wash down machinery, equipment, and vehicles.
